Who We Are

Since our founding in 2000, African American Voter Registration, Education, and Participation (AAVREP)’s mission has been to increase African American and urban voter registration, education, and civic participation.

Through partnerships with community, labor and religious organizations, AAVREP empowers individuals and neighborhoods one vote at a time.

Throughout California history, Black voters have been our most consistent Democratic voting block, standing strong against conservative efforts to roll back civil rights and equal opportunity.


From the State House to the White House, African Americans are currently leading the resistance to those who would destroy the progress we have made through 200 years of struggle.

What Some Call Work, We Call Commitment

  • Registered more than 250,000 voters and counting (as verified by the Los Angeles County Registrar).
  •  Trained more than 5,000 Community-Based Team Members in voter registration and mobilization.
  •  Contacted nearly 400,000 households to help Get-Out-The-Vote at the door and on the phone.
  • Developed a statewide email database of African Americans eligible and registered to vote.
  •  Conducted extensive focus groups and public opinion surveys of African American voters in federal, state, and local elections.
  • Conducted Ecumenical Leadership meetings to educate and engage congregants of faith based organizations to encourage greater participation in civic and electoral processes.
  • Strategically targeted and deployed Team Members to thousands of precincts and polling places to help educate, persuade and mobilize African American voters in federal, state, and state elections.
